Recently from last 2 batch of uploads Shutterstock rejected all of my photos with some various reasons. I don't know if they are dying, someone hate me at SS or they don't like Easter.
I had a photoshoot with Easter decoration, Eggs in a basket with white rabbit, just a batch of 40 photos, and every few days when I have time I work on few of them and upload to bunch of stock websites.
First batch of uploads was 10 photos and many of them got accepted except couple being duplicated, which is reasonable. Next 2 times I uploaded again 10 photos and another 12 photos.
Shutterstock rejected all of them even though they are from same batch, same quality, good lighting.
I uploaded all these photos to different stock websites also at the same time and other websites accepted almost all of the photos if not all.
And now I have Alamy, Depositphotos, Pond5, 123RF accepted all 32 photos, with Adobe and BigStock rejected few of them for being too similar. But Shutterstock rejecting all of them from 2nd and 3rd batch of uploads and now I have only 6 accepted from them.
This is very strange as Shutterstock usually accept 90% of my photos uploaded.
Did you have similar problems lately, should I try to reupload photos again for 2nd round of review, maybe write something in note for reviewer or just forget it?
